/**
* nand_read_subpage - [ REPLACABLE ] software ecc based sub - page read function
* @ mtd : mtd info structure
* @ chip : nand chip info structure
* @ dataofs offset of requested data within the page
* @ readlen data length
* @ buf : buffer to store read data
*/
static int nand_read_subpage ( struct mtd_info * mtd , struct nand_chip * chip , uint32_t data_offs , uint32_t readlen , uint8_t * bufpoi )
{
int start_step , end_step , num_steps ;
uint32_t * eccpos = chip - > ecc . layout - > eccpos ;
uint8_t * p ;
int data_col_addr , i , gaps = 0 ;
int datafrag_len , eccfrag_len , aligned_len , aligned_pos ;
int busw = ( chip - > options & NAND_BUSWIDTH_16 ) ? 2 : 1 ;
/* Column address wihin the page aligned to ECC size (256bytes). */
start_step = data_offs / chip - > ecc . size ;
end_step = ( data_offs + readlen - 1 ) / chip - > ecc . size ;
num_steps = end_step - start_step + 1 ;
/* Data size aligned to ECC ecc.size*/
datafrag_len = num_steps * chip - > ecc . size ;
eccfrag_len = num_steps * chip - > ecc . bytes ;
data_col_addr = start_step * chip - > ecc . size ;
/* If we read not a page aligned data */
if ( data_col_addr ! = 0 )
chip - > cmdfunc ( mtd , NAND_CMD_RNDOUT , data_col_addr , - 1 ) ;
p = bufpoi + data_col_addr ;
chip - > read_buf ( mtd , p , datafrag_len ) ;
/* Calculate ECC */
for ( i = 0 ; i < eccfrag_len ; i + = chip - > ecc . bytes , p + = chip - > ecc . size )
chip - > ecc . calculate ( mtd , p , & chip - > buffers - > ecccalc [ i ] ) ;
/* The performance is faster if to position offsets
according to ecc . pos . Let make sure here that
there are no gaps in ecc positions */
for ( i = 0 ; i < eccfrag_len - 1 ; i + + ) {
if ( eccpos [ i + start_step * chip - > ecc . bytes ] + 1 ! =
eccpos [ i + start_step * chip - > ecc . bytes + 1 ] ) {
gaps = 1 ;
break ;
}
}
if ( gaps ) {
chip - > cmdfunc ( mtd , NAND_CMD_RNDOUT , mtd - > writesize , - 1 ) ;
chip - > read_buf ( mtd , chip - > oob_poi , mtd - > oobsize ) ;
} else {
/* send the command to read the particular ecc bytes */
/* take care about buswidth alignment in read_buf */
aligned_pos = eccpos [ start_step * chip - > ecc . bytes ] & ~ ( busw - 1 ) ;
aligned_len = eccfrag_len ;
if ( eccpos [ start_step * chip - > ecc . bytes ] & ( busw - 1 ) )
aligned_len + + ;
if ( eccpos [ ( start_step + num_steps ) * chip - > ecc . bytes ] & ( busw - 1 ) )
aligned_len + + ;
chip - > cmdfunc ( mtd , NAND_CMD_RNDOUT , mtd - > writesize + aligned_pos , - 1 ) ;
chip - > read_buf ( mtd , & chip - > oob_poi [ aligned_pos ] , aligned_len ) ;
}
for ( i = 0 ; i < eccfrag_len ; i + + )
chip - > buffers - > ecccode [ i ] = chip - > oob_poi [ eccpos [ i + start_step * chip - > ecc . bytes ] ] ;
p = bufpoi + data_col_addr ;
for ( i = 0 ; i < eccfrag_len ; i + = chip - > ecc . bytes , p + = chip - > ecc . size ) {
int stat ;
stat = chip - > ecc . correct ( mtd , p , & chip - > buffers - > ecccode [ i ] , & chip - > buffers - > ecccalc [ i ] ) ;
if ( stat < 0 )
mtd - > ecc_stats . failed + + ;
else
mtd - > ecc_stats . corrected + = stat ;

@ -2367,6 +2457,26 @@ static struct nand_flash_dev *nand_get_flash_type(struct mtd_info *mtd,
* maf_id = chip - > read_byte ( mtd ) ;
dev_id = chip - > read_byte ( mtd ) ;
/* Try again to make sure, as some systems the bus-hold or other
* interface concerns can cause random data which looks like a
* possibly credible NAND flash to appear . If the two results do
* not match , ignore the device completely .
*/
chip - > cmdfunc ( mtd , NAND_CMD_READID , 0x00 , - 1 ) ;
/* Read manufacturer and device IDs */
tmp_manf = chip - > read_byte ( mtd ) ;
tmp_id = chip - > read_byte ( mtd ) ;
if ( tmp_manf ! = * maf_id | | tmp_id ! = dev_id ) {
printk ( KERN_INFO " %s: second ID read did not match "
" %02x,%02x against %02x,%02x \n " , __func__ ,
* maf_id , dev_id , tmp_manf , tmp_id ) ;
return ERR_PTR ( - ENODEV ) ;
}
